Output 30c4aae0310894e9906104cbc3e5ba3c96f7b896aed624da57e42fa2821b0276:3

value
16129669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1daa5a76e1151d0ef1e13259dc7d0afc58c56c9b OP_EQUAL
address
MAc1uMSzfxRUigP8Yf8KrG6WzCGBrzxe2m
transaction
30c4aae0310894e9906104cbc3e5ba3c96f7b896aed624da57e42fa2821b0276
spent
true